### RestockPilot: Release Prerequisites

Before cutting a release, confirm that the RestockPilot planner can reach the SnackGrid inventory service, since the build pipeline runs an integration smoke test against staging during packaging. A failed handshake here blocks the release tag, so verify credentials first. The pipeline reads its staging credential from the deploy config; for reference and manual verification, the current key appears below.

service key, tajof-fawip: vxb4-JNOz

Hey Dov — quick handover before I head out. Weekly cash-box run is prepped: both boxes counted, sealed, and logged in the Ledgerline book as usual. Tills reconciled, no discrepancies this week. Courier from Swiftmoor is due between 10 and 11 tomorrow; don't let the run slip past noon like last time. When the driver arrives, follow this hand-over instruction exactly.

dispatch memo: the silok lamdor courier leaves the pramir tamix julax ledger at gate 7050 under passcode 555680

# Runbook: Fleet Fuel-Usage Report (Ridgeway Haulage)

Runs nightly at 02:15. Pulls odometer and pump logs from the Tanker sync bucket, joins on vehicle slug, writes CSV to the reports share. If the job stalls, check the Pumpwell ingest queue first — it backs up when depot uplinks drop. Rerun with --from-date after clearing the queue. Do not rerun twice in one night; duplicates skew the weekly totals. The report uploader authenticates to the reports share with a credential set on the next line.

sealed setting: COURIER_KEY29=170ad45524657711572101e080d15